Bryan and Adam have some stickers.
23 of Bryan's stickers is 60 less than
35 of Adam's stickers.
Adam has 270 stickers.
- How many stickers does Bryan have?
- How many stickers do Bryan and Adam have altogether?
- How many stickers does Adam have more than Bryan?
(a)
Make the numerators the same.
2x33x3 of Bryan's stickers =
3x25x2 of Adam's stickers - 60
69 of Bryan's stickers =
610 of Adam's stickers - 60
Let
110 of Adam's stickers be 1 u.
Number of stickers that Adam has = 10 u
10 u = 270
1 u = 270 ÷ 10 = 27
69 of Bryan's stickers = 6 u - 60
19 of Bryan's stickers = 1 u - 10
99 of Bryan's stickers = 9 u - 90
Number of stickers that Bryan has
= 9 u - 90
= 9 x 27 - 90
= 243 - 90
= 153
(b)
Number of stickers that Bryan and Adam have altogether
= 9 u - 90 + 10 u
= 153 + 10 x 27
= 153 + 270
= 423
(c)
Number of stickers that Adam have more than Bryan
= 270 - 153
= 117
Answer(s): (a) 153; (b) 423; (c) 117
